1. Improved Accuracy and Error Reduction
Medication errors are one of the most significant risks in healthcare, often resulting from illegible handwriting or miscommunication between providers and pharmacies. Advanced Electronic Prescribing Systems eliminate these risks by digitizing every aspect of the prescribing process.

3. Enhanced Compliance and Security
Regulatory compliance is a top priority in today’s healthcare environment. Advanced Electronic Prescribing Systems ensure adherence to federal and state regulations, including HIPAA for data protection and DEA requirements for electronic prescribing of controlled substances (EPCS).

4. Seamless Integration with Health IT Systems
The best Electronic Prescribing Systems don’t work in isolation—they integrate seamlessly with other healthcare technologies. Modern systems connect directly with Electronic Health Records (EHRs), Pharmacy Management Systems, and Practice Management Software.
